    Swiss designer to visit RIT

    Laser cutters, pantographs and letterpress printing presses are just a few of the tools Swiss graphic designer Dafi Kuhne uses to produce one-of-a-kind poster designs. The artist will visit RIT May 3 to discuss his unique fusion of digital and analog techniques.

    RIT among hosts of NASA Space Apps Challenge

    RIT is one of 200 host sites from around the world for the two-day hackathon. The 2017 NASA International Space Apps Challenge is designed to engage thousands of problem-solvers in working with NASA to create solutions to international and interdisciplinary problems using open-source data.

    RIT motorsport teams unveil new race vehicles

    RIT’s three sleek Formula racecars, Baja off-road vehicle, Hot Wheelz hybrid electric Formula car and EVO, the electric motorcycle, all built by RIT students, will be unveiled as part of the Imagine RIT festival on May 6.
